Structural Glass Properties: wired_glass

Mechanical, thermal, and optical properties for architectural and structural glass types. Covers annealed float (3-19 mm), heat-strengthened (4-15 mm), fully tempered (4-19 mm), laminated annealed and tempered (PVB and SGP interlayers), insulating glass units (double clear, double low-E, double high-performance, triple clear, triple low-E), chemically strengthened (2-3 mm), wired glass, and ceramic frit tempered glass. Each record includes density, elastic modulus, Poisson's ratio, characteristic strength, allowable stress (short and long duration), surface compressive stress range, thermal expansion coefficient, thermal conductivity, U-value (IGU), SHGC, visible transmittance, breakage pattern, and deflection limit. 43 records per EN 572/EN 16612, ASTM E1300, ASTM C1048, and NFRC standards.
